We opened our doors to the public in our brick and mortar store in 2018. We receive donations that we sell in the thrift store to fund our vocational training and "other" opportunities for those on the spectrum in our community. We do not receive any government grant funding - relying solely on grass-roots fundraising and the volunteers who help run the store. Our goal is to become a "one stop shop" providing myriad resources for those on the spectrum; including (not limited to) therapy, aftercare, daily life skills, workshops and support groups (on-line and in person).
